Thanksgiving Card with Rays

This card was sparked by a technique challenge on the Paper Wishes Message Board.  The challenge was to make a card using rays for the background as described here. Because I knew I wanted to make a Thanksgiving card, I decided to use yellow card stock instead of white and make my rays a variety of oranges, browns, golds and coppers (inks from various stamp pads).  I also inked the edge with copper.

The focal is the Pumpkin Small Stamp from Hot Off the Press. I stamped it in copper and then colored it in with metallic cream chalks. The sentiment was stamped (also in copper) with stamps I made using my Stampmaker. The focal and mat (autumn leaves paper) were die cut using my Resplendent Rectangles set (from Spellbinders).  A bit of ribbon and some tiny accent stickers for the upper corners, and I was done.
